I am one of many whom have been suckered by CMC, I signed a contract with them and the only contacted made was my calling them. I always get the same thing, "we have a big event this weekend and feel it will sell" After seeing the report and talking to several other resort resell places, I began doing some investigation on my own. This is how I found usacomplaints.com and a group on yahoo against CMC. I signed with CMC the end of january 06, I did check the BBB and they were a member then but were removed shortly after.
I have tried to call the sales person whom I signed with and have been told she is unavailable (out on recruit to sell my property), down to the most recent (08/23/06) that she no longer worked for them. I really wish I could find Jean Neal. I was told by her that there was no time table involved in selling my property but to speak realistically, it WOULD sell in 3-4 months, it has now been 7 months and not even 1 offer on the property.
I spoke with the customer service dept. And was told the same thing as always, then when I informed them I was aware of the investigation into the practices of CMC, I was told it was all a disgruntled employee that was trying to close them down and it was not true, non of it.
I have no faith in the company but am under contract til Jan. 07. I am, at this point, just hopeing to get my money back. I have reread the contract I have on file and it does state all money will be refunded if not sold with-in a year. Pray for me that I get it back. I will be filing a complaint with the FLA. AG office next.
